Output 3e80be5bbfbdc0d9bc29e12c6e4cf57af30de80a54e0ffd84e23375cae8b691e:0

value
14439761597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d25b1e391720c8c1b1b59ed70de156c21d7d3b OP_EQUAL
address
33xG8w7yukaTKUwhHcy9AqxqMD8Fhjzeo6
transaction
3e80be5bbfbdc0d9bc29e12c6e4cf57af30de80a54e0ffd84e23375cae8b691e
confirmations
335986
spent
true